Transaction 33cbde16fe85b78ba2dcdca4ec50012f23af109dc7c5a51bfa63bc4141c41fa9

3 Input
1 Outputs
  • 33cbde16fe85b78ba2dcdca4ec50012f23af109dc7c5a51bfa63bc4141c41fa9:0
  • value  124116
    address  37drADEgimFvd7iXoeLMPXnZ2tYnm1mjbx